The cooled water is then returned to the chiller to absorb more heat energy and repeat the cycle. In essence, the condenser water system connects the chiller to the cooling tower through supply and return piping. Water cooled in the tower is “supplied” to the chiller, which adds heat to the water and “returns” it to the tower. Domestic Hot Water Recirculation.

Water -cooled condensers and chiller barrels are specialized heat exchangers. They exchange heat by removing heat from one fluid and transferring it to another fluid. A water -cooled condenser is a heat exchanger that removes heat from refrigerant vapor and transfers it to the water running through it.

Much changes when the condenser water flow is reduced. As previously mentioned: † Pump power goes down. Chiller power rises (as flow rate goes down, leaving condenser water temperature rises).


Evaporative condensers are frequently used to reject heat from mechanical refrigeration systems. The evaporative condenser is essentially a combination of a water -cooled condenser and an air-cooled condenser , utilizing the principle of heat rejection by the evaporation of water into an air stream traveling across the condensing coil. The dumped water requires replacement in the system, and the replacement water is usually potable water from the local water utility. The amount of water removed and replaced is highly dependant on the level of minerals, measured as Total Dissolved Solids (TDS) contained in the potable water supply. BACKGROUND Cooling Tower A cooling tower cools down the condensing water used in the condenser of the chiller. The annual labor for cleaning a water -cooled condenser averages from 50- to 75-percent less than that required for cleaning an air-cooled condenser. A 400-ton water -cooled system will have a condenser water pump, a back-up water pump, and one or two tower fans and one compressor - each of these components requires routine maintenance.

Lowering the chilled water supply temperature will result in some combination of increased chiller cost and reduced chiller performance. Increasing the condenser water temperature range will reduce the condenser pump, pipe and cooling tower sizes, saving capital costs.
